Voltage supplied to the motor.
Motor frequency, i.e. the output frequency from the frequency converter in Hz.
Phase current of the motor measured as effective value.
Motor frequency, i.e. the output frequency from the frequency converter in percent.
Present motor load as a percentage of the rated motor torque.
Speed in RPM (motor shaft speed in revolutions per minute). The accuracy is dependent on the set slip com-
pensation, par. 1-62 or on the motor speed feedback - if available.
Thermal load on the motor, calculated by the ETR function. See also parameter group 1-9* Motor Temperature.
Shows the actual torque produced, in percentage.
Intermediate circuit voltage in the frequency converter.
Present brake power transferred to an external brake resistor.
Stated as an instantaneous value.
Brake power transferred to an external brake resistor. The mean power is calculated continuously for the most
recent 120 seconds.
Present heat sink temperature of the frequency converter. The cut-out limit is 95 ±5 oC; cutting back in occurs
at 70 ±5° C.
Percentage load of the inverters
Nominal current of the frequency converter
Maximum current of the frequency converter
State of the event executed by the control
Temperature of the control card.
Sum of the external reference as a percentage, i.e. the sum of analog/pulse/bus.
Reference value from programmed digital input(s).
View the contribution of the digital potentiometer to the actual reference Feedback.
View the value of Feedback 1. See also par. 20-0*.
View the value of Feedback 2. See also par. 20-0*.
View the value of Feedback 3. See also par. 20-0*.
Displays the status of the digital inputs. Signal low = 0; Signal high = 1.
Regarding order, see par. 16-60. Bit 0 is at the extreme right.
53
Switch
Setting of input terminal 53. Current = 0; Voltage = 1.
Actual value at input 53 either as a reference or protection value.
54
Switch
Setting of input terminal 54. Current = 0; Voltage = 1.
Actual value at input 54 either as reference or protection value.
Binary value of all digital outputs.
Actual value of the frequency applied at terminal 29 as a pulse input.
Actual value of the frequency applied at terminal 33 as a pulse input.
View the setting of all relays.
View the present value of Counter A.
View the present value of Counter B.
Actual value of the signal on input X30/11 (General Purpose I/O Card. Option)
Actual value of the signal on input X30/12 (General Purpose I/O Card. Optional)
Actual value at output X30/8 (General Purpose I/O Card. Optional) Use Par. 6-60 to select the variable to be
shown.
